Transaction 895b45b80235204400ddfd11cd9f75d5a970217651153464d0c93a58c339d4ac
1 Input
1 Output
-
895b45b80235204400ddfd11cd9f75d5a970217651153464d0c93a58c339d4ac:0
- value
- 14151106
- script pubkey
- OP_0 OP_PUSHBYTES_20 ee2a9ca13d77a1642d517b8f1fe8c5faceda2807
- address
- bc1qac4fegfaw7skgt230w83l6x9lt8d52q8nxecev